CAT 307 Overview
The CAT 307 is part of Caterpillar's 300-series of excavators, designed to provide the performance and capabilities needed for both light and medium-duty construction jobs. With a bucket capacity ranging from 0.1 m³ to 0.4 m³, and an operating weight around 7,000 kg (depending on the configuration), the CAT 307 offers a perfect balance between power and compactness. Operators appreciate the machine's ability to dig to depths of about 4.6 meters (15 feet), while maintaining a relatively small footprint, making it ideal for urban construction and tight job sites.
A key selling point of the CAT 307 is its advanced hydraulic system. The machine boasts improved fuel efficiency and faster cycle times, which help maximize productivity on the job site. Additionally, operators have reported that the machine’s cabin is well-designed for comfort, with good visibility and ergonomic controls.
Operator Feedback on Performance
From the feedback of several CAT 307 operators, several common themes emerge regarding the machine’s performance and handling.
- Versatility in Tight Spaces
The CAT 307 is highly regarded for its ability to operate in confined spaces. Thanks to its compact size, it is ideal for use in residential areas, road maintenance, landscaping, and other jobs where maneuverability is a priority. Operators often mention that it is particularly useful in urban construction, where it can easily work in narrow alleys or tight spaces that other, larger machines can't access.
- Hydraulic Power and Speed
The hydraulic system on the CAT 307 is one of its standout features. Operators appreciate its smooth operation, which helps increase efficiency when digging, lifting, and handling materials. The powerful hydraulics allow for fast cycle times, making it suitable for projects that require high productivity.
The auxiliary hydraulics also make the machine adaptable for various attachments, such as hydraulic breakers, augers, and tilt buckets. This versatility makes it an excellent choice for contractors who require flexibility in their equipment.
- Fuel Efficiency
Several operators have highlighted the CAT 307’s fuel efficiency as one of its most appealing characteristics. Despite its powerful hydraulic system, the machine consumes less fuel compared to larger models, helping to lower operating costs over time. For contractors running multiple machines on a project, this efficiency can make a significant difference in terms of overall project costs.
- Smooth and Comfortable Ride
Comfort is another key factor that CAT 307 operators mention. The cab is well-designed with air conditioning, adjustable seating, and user-friendly controls. The low noise levels inside the cab make long hours of operation more manageable. The suspension system on the undercarriage also helps reduce vibrations, improving the ride quality.
No machine is without its challenges, and the CAT 307 is no exception. However, many of the issues that operators report are relatively minor and can be easily managed with regular maintenance and care.
- Hydraulic System Maintenance
While the CAT 307’s hydraulic system is generally praised for its performance, some operators have reported issues with maintaining the system over time, particularly the seals and hoses. As with any hydraulic system, regular inspection and maintenance are necessary to ensure optimal performance. Operators recommend frequent checks for leaks and ensuring that the hydraulic fluid levels are consistent to prevent unnecessary wear on the system.
- Undercarriage Wear
Another common issue with the CAT 307 is the undercarriage, especially in harsh conditions where it may encounter excessive wear and tear. Operators working in areas with rough terrain or heavy lifting demands have noted that the undercarriage may need to be inspected and replaced more frequently. Regular cleaning and lubrication can help extend the life of the tracks and sprockets, reducing the risk of premature failure.
- Electrical System Issues
A few operators have also experienced electrical issues, particularly related to the electrical connections in the cab. Some have reported faulty sensors or wiring problems that can affect performance. Ensuring that the electrical connections are secure and routinely inspected can help avoid these types of problems.
- Limited Boom Reach
While the CAT 307 is great for compact, tight spaces, some operators have noted that its boom length can sometimes be a limitation for tasks requiring a longer reach. For larger-scale excavating jobs, this could be a potential drawback, especially when digging at deeper depths. The reach might not be sufficient for larger projects, requiring operators to consider alternative models or attachments for certain tasks.
To keep the CAT 307 in top working condition, operators generally recommend the following maintenance practices:
- Regular Hydraulic System Inspection: Check for any leaks, worn seals, or damaged hoses. Keeping the hydraulic system in peak condition ensures that the machine performs at its best and reduces the risk of costly repairs.
- Track and Undercarriage Care: Operators should frequently inspect and clean the undercarriage. Keep the tracks lubricated and check for any signs of wear that may require attention. Regular maintenance of the undercarriage helps prevent costly downtime.
- Keep the Cab Clean: A clean cab not only improves the operator's comfort and visibility but also extends the life of the electrical and control systems.
- Service the Engine and Filters: Like any other machine, the CAT 307 requires regular engine service, including oil changes, air filter replacements, and checking for coolant leaks. A well-maintained engine performs better and consumes less fuel.
